Output e28609840b71a2a71d220f4e0e68426cedd82a8ebcfe024fea43f51c6229828f:0

value
10497743
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1ee2b7d24b5f441a9858fd04481bef772ebea52 OP_EQUALVERIFY OP_CHECKSIG
address
1L91YRhSCHDq12kipCHRxRC5MyjUABqsb7
transaction
e28609840b71a2a71d220f4e0e68426cedd82a8ebcfe024fea43f51c6229828f
spent
true